Had to go defend the 2024 ACBM title with a dub to start year.
I tried to catch them deep, but it wasn’t happening for me. Every fish came on a Green Pumpkin Shakey in 5-10 ft of water near lay downs.
Weather was 37° with off and on rain ☔️. Not the biggest field because of it but a win is a win. Took home the big fish pot as well.

So I’m working on snow/ice on my gravel driveway and I noticed this that relates to fishing. Our temperature this week have been below freezing all day long but mostly sunny. So the gravel still heats up and is melting the frozen snow. Each day we are getting a fraction more daylight so imagine why the fish like rock in cold water. As long as the sun can reach the rock in the waterway it will heat up no matter the water temperature. The bigger the rock surface the more heat potential. Be intentional when fishing!
